The preliminary step within the asbestos roof removal process involves an intensive inspection. Professionals assess the condition of the roofing materials containing asbestos and identify the extent of the contamination. This evaluation helps determine the most effective approach for removal and disposal. Proper identification is crucial, as it guides all subsequent actions regarding safety protocols and regulatory compliance.

Before initiating the removal itself, a containment area is established. Barriers have to be erected to forestall the unfold of asbestos fibers during the process. This containment zone ought to be outfitted with unfavorable air stress techniques to additional limit any potential contamination. Warning signs must be posted prominently, alerting everyone to the presence of hazardous materials.


During the actual removal, staff wear specialised protective gear, together with respirators, disposable coveralls, and gloves. The materials are handled gently to attenuate the release of fibers. Asbestos-containing materials must be wetted down earlier than being disturbed to assist forestall airborne particles. Careful methods, similar to eradicating entire sections quite than breaking materials into smaller items, are key to sustaining a protected surroundings.


Once the roofing materials are eliminated, they must be packaged correctly for disposal. Specific waste containers designed for asbestos disposal are utilized to ensure containment of the hazardous material. These containers must be adequately labeled and sealed to convey the nature of the waste. Strict guidelines outline tips on how to seal and dispose of these materials to mitigate any potential health impacts.

Transporting the asbestos waste requires adherence to stringent regulations. Only licensed contractors or automobiles designated for hazardous waste are permitted for this transport. The waste is often taken to specialized disposal websites that are licensed to handle asbestos. Facilities are equipped to handle such materials safely, guaranteeing that they don't pose a danger to the setting or public health.




After transportation, given the hazardous nature of asbestos, the receiving facility should keep stringent protocols for managing the disposed materials. The facility will often have a process that entails high-temperature incineration or secure landfilling, specifically designed to mitigate dangers associated with asbestos. Documentation relating to the transport and disposal course of is also essential; information should be stored to path the waste from removal to ultimate disposal.

  • Ensure proper identification of asbestos-containing materials earlier than commencing removal procedures to avoid security hazards.

  • Establish a designated containment space across the worksite to stop the unfold of asbestos fibers during removal.

  • Use applicable private protective tools (PPE), including respirators, disposable coveralls, and gloves, to guard employees from exposure.

  • Employ moist removal techniques by saturating materials with water or a wetting agent to attenuate airborne asbestos particles.

  • Carefully take away asbestos roofing materials using hand instruments to keep away from breakage and release of fibers into the air.

  • Implement adverse air stress systems to filter and ventilate the work area, lowering the risk of contamination.

  • Properly label and seal asbestos waste in accredited, leak-tight containers to make sure secure transportation and disposal.

  • Follow local, state, and federal regulations for transporting asbestos waste to approved disposal websites, ensuring compliance throughout the method.

  • Conduct air monitoring earlier than, throughout, and after removal to assess the effectiveness of containment measures and ensure safety.

How can I ensure the protected disposal of asbestos materials?undefinedSafe disposal involves putting asbestos materials in sealed, labeled bags earlier than transporting them to a you can try here licensed landfill. It’s essential to observe local regulations and guidelines for hazardous waste disposal to prevent environmental contamination.


What are the authorized requirements for asbestos roof removal in my area?undefinedLegal necessities vary by location however often embrace requirements for hiring licensed contractors, notifying native authorities, and following specific security regulations. Consulting native health and safety regulations is essential prior to beginning any demolition work.


How do I choose a certified contractor for asbestos roof removal?undefinedLook for contractors who are licensed, insured, and have expertise in asbestos removal. Check their certifications and reviews, and ask for references to ensure they observe safety protocols and have a stable reputation within the trade.


What personal protecting equipment (PPE) ought to be used throughout asbestos roof removal?undefinedDuring asbestos removal, workers ought to put on appropriate PPE, together with respirators, disposable coveralls, gloves, and eye protection. This gear helps decrease exposure to asbestos fibers, protecting employee health.

How lengthy does the asbestos roof removal process typically take?undefinedThe period of the removal course of can vary from a number of hours to several days relying on the scale and situation of the roof, as well as the complexity of the removal. A professional assessment can present a extra correct timeline.


Are there alternate options to removing an asbestos roof?undefinedEncapsulation and sealing the existing roof can be viable options. These methods contain making use of a sealant to forestall fiber launch however ought to solely be considered if the roof is in good condition and not damaged.


What health risks are related to asbestos publicity throughout roof removal?undefinedAsbestos publicity can result in critical health points, together with lung most cancers, mesothelioma, and asbestosis. These dangers improve with the period and depth of publicity, making security protocols throughout removal crucial.


Can I remove an asbestos roof myself?undefinedIt is strongly advised towards removing asbestos roofing without professional assistance. DIY removal poses significant health risks because of potential fiber release and may violate local regulations, resulting in authorized repercussions.
